Access look-up wiring diagrams, component locations, and step-by-step repair guides directly linked to the fault codes you discover. System Requirements for Version 5.3
| Component | Minimum / Recommended Requirement | | :--- | :--- | | | Windows 8.1 Pro, Windows 10 Pro, or Windows 11 Pro (Windows 7 is not supported for version 5.3). | | CPU | Any x86 (Intel/AMD) dual-core processor or better. ARM-based CPUs (e.g., Snapdragon) are not supported . | | RAM | 8 GB of system memory or more. | | Storage (HDD/SSD) | A minimum of 180 GB of free hard drive space is required for the program and its data. You will find advertisements for "John Deere Service Advisor 5.3" on various third-party diagnostic websites and forums (like binunlock.com, mhhauto.com, or obd2diag.com) often priced between $250 and $500. These are typically not official resellers. While they may provide working software clones or hard drives loaded with the database, they generally do not offer valid licenses, official technical support, or liability for damage.

Official access to Service Advisor is available through authorized channels, though version 5.3 has largely been superseded by version 5.4. Official Purchase : You can buy a subscription directly from JohnDeereStore.com or via local John Deere dealers. Third-Party Packages : Various providers like offer pre-loaded laptops or remote installation services. Hardware Required : The software strictly requires a John Deere Electronic Data Link (EDL) adapter (versions V2 or V3) to connect to machines. : When connected via an Electronic Data Link
